By Representative Kilcoyne of Clinton, a petition (accompanied by bill, House, No. 1072) of 
Meghan Kilcoyne and Edward R. Philips relative to healthcare coverage for behavioral health 
and nutrition counseling. Financial Services.
The Commonwealth of Massachusetts
_______________
In the One Hundred and Ninety-Third General Court
(2023-2024)
_______________
An Act relative to behavioral health and nutrition counseling.
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Court assembled, and by the authority 
of the same, as follows:
1 SECTION 1. Subsection (a) of section 30 of chapter 32A of the General Laws, as 
2inserted by section 3 of chapter 260 of the acts of 2020, is hereby amended by striking out the 
3words “substance use disorders” and inserting in place thereof the following words:- substance 
4use disorders and care and services provided by a dietitian/nutritionist licensed pursuant to 
5sections 201 to 210, inclusive, of chapter 112 of the General Laws. 
6 SECTION 2. Subsection (a) of section 79 of chapter 118E of the General Laws, as 
7inserted by section 40 of chapter 260 of the acts of 2020, is hereby amended by striking out the 
8words “substance use disorders” and inserting in place thereof the following words:- substance 
9use disorders and care and services provided by a dietitian/nutritionist licensed pursuant to 
10sections 201 to 210, inclusive, of chapter 112 of the General Laws.
